Notice: Function wp_register_script was called incorrectly. Unrecognized key(s) in the $args param: defer. Supported keys: strategy, in_footer, fetchpriority, module_dependencies Please see Debugging in WordPress for more information. (This message was added in version 7.0.0.) in /home/johnodev/staging/gfm.johnodev.com/wp-includes/functions.php on line 6170

Notice: Function wp_register_script was called incorrectly. Unrecognized key(s) in the $args param: defer. Supported keys: strategy, in_footer, fetchpriority, module_dependencies Please see Debugging in WordPress for more information. (This message was added in version 7.0.0.) in /home/johnodev/staging/gfm.johnodev.com/wp-includes/functions.php on line 6170
Sector: Leisure - GFM

Leisure

Keeping leisure facilities running smoothly for staff and visitors alike — from routine maintenance to reactive response across pools, gyms, and hospitality venues.

No content found in this sector.